Amaranth 'Emerald Tassels'
Amaranthus cruentus
Emerald Tassels features stunning chartreuse botanical cascades, ideal for creating dramatic, eye-catching designs. Easy to grow and versatile, amaranth boasts a rich history that spans over 6,000 years of cultivation. Its revival in both gardens and floral arrangements began during the Victorian era, where it captivated designers. Today, with modern varieties in elevated color palettes, amaranth remains a favorite in floral design.

DETAILS
Plant type: Annual
Days to maturity: 65–75 days
Light preference: Full sun
Plant spacing: 12 inches
Plant height: 40–48 inches
Hybrid status: Open pollinated
SOWING
Depth: ¼ inch
Days to germination: 7–10 days at 70–75°F
How to Grow
Sow indoors 4–6 weeks before transplanting out. May also be direct sown after all danger of frost. Space closer for smaller stems or pinch to encourage branching.
Harvest & Vase Life
Fresh: Harvest when flowers are 1/2 to 3/4 open for fresh. Dried: Harvest when seed start to develop and heads feel firm. Remove all foliage. Stand up trailing varieties in a bucket to maintain draped appearance. Hang upright varieties upside down.
Expected vase life: 7–15 days.
